Danh sách kiểm tra cấu hình hệ thống giám sát cho blog có lưu lượng truy cập cao
Trong thời đại số hiện nay, việc duy trì một blog với lưu lượng truy cập cao không chỉ đòi hỏi nội dung chất lượng mà còn cần một hạ tầng kỹ thuật vững chắc. Một trong những yếu tố quan trọng nhất để đảm bảo hiệu suất và tính sẵn sàng của blog là hệ thống giám sát cấu hình. Bài viết này sẽ cung cấp một danh sách kiểm tra chi tiết để giám sát cấu hình hệ thống cho blog có lưu lượng truy cập cao, giúp bạn tối ưu hóa hiệu suất và trải nghiệm người dùng.
Các yếu tố quan trọng trong hệ thống giám sát
1. Tài nguyên máy chủ
Máy chủ là nền tảng cho bất kỳ blog nào. Để đảm bảo rằng máy chủ của bạn có thể xử lý lưu lượng truy cập cao, hãy xem xét các yếu tố sau:
- CPU: Kiểm tra số lượng lõi và tốc độ xung nhịp. Nên sử dụng máy chủ với CPU đa lõi.
- Bộ nhớ RAM: Đảm bảo máy chủ có đủ bộ nhớ để xử lý các yêu cầu đồng thời. 8GB RAM là tối thiểu cho blog với lưu lượng truy cập cao.
- Đĩa cứng: Sử dụng ổ SSD để tăng tốc độ truy cập dữ liệu. Đảm bảo ổ cứng có dung lượng lớn để chứa tất cả nội dung.
2. Cấu hình phần mềm
Cấu hình phần mềm cũng quan trọng không kém. Hệ điều hành và phần mềm máy chủ cần được tối ưu hóa:
- Hệ điều hành: Cập nhật thường xuyên để bảo mật và tối ưu hiệu suất.
- Phần mềm máy chủ web: Sử dụng Apache, Nginx hoặc LiteSpeed và cấu hình cho phù hợp với lưu lượng người dùng.
- PHP và cơ sở dữ liệu: Sử dụng phiên bản PHP mới nhất và tối ưu hóa cơ sở dữ liệu MySQL hoặc MariaDB.
Danh sách kiểm tra giám sát hệ thống
Dưới đây là danh sách kiểm tra giám sát cấu hình hệ thống cho blog có lưu lượng truy cập cao:
| Yếu tố | Thông tin chi tiết | Trạng thái |
|---|---|---|
| CPU | Số lõi >= 4, tốc độ >= 2.5GHz | [ ] Đạt / [ ] Không đạt |
| Bộ nhớ RAM | 8GB trở lên | [ ] Đạt / [ ] Không đạt |
| Ổ cứng | SSD, dung lượng >= 100GB | [ ] Đạt / [ ] Không đạt |
| Hệ điều hành | Phiên bản cập nhật và hỗ trợ | [ ] Đạt / [ ] Không đạt |
| Phần mềm máy chủ web | Apache/Nginx/LiteSpeed | [ ] Đạt / [ ] Không đạt |
| PHP | Phiên bản >= 7.4 | [ ] Đạt / [ ] Không đạt |
| Cơ sở dữ liệu | MySQL >= 5.7 hoặc MariaDB >= 10.2 | [ ] Đạt / [ ] Không đạt |
Các công cụ giám sát hệ thống
Để theo dõi hiệu suất và tình trạng của hệ thống, bạn có thể sử dụng một số công cụ sau:
1. New Relic
New Relic là một công cụ mạnh mẽ cho phép giám sát ứng dụng và máy chủ. Nó cung cấp thông tin chi tiết về hiệu suất, thời gian phản hồi và các lỗi xảy ra trong ứng dụng.
2. Nagios
Nagios là một công cụ mã nguồn mở cho phép giám sát toàn bộ hạ tầng IT. Nó theo dõi máy chủ, dịch vụ và thậm chí cả các ứng dụng để đảm bảo mọi thứ hoạt động như mong đợi.
3. Zabbix
Giống như Nagios, Zabbix cũng là một công cụ mã nguồn mở với khả năng giám sát toàn diện. Nó cung cấp các cảnh báo theo thời gian thực và báo cáo chi tiết về tình trạng của hệ thống.
Phân tích hiệu suất
Hệ thống giám sát không chỉ đơn thuần theo dõi các thông số mà còn cần phân tích hiệu suất của blog để kịp thời phát hiện và khắc phục các vấn đề:
1. Thời gian tải trang
Thời gian tải trang ảnh hưởng đến trải nghiệm người dùng và SEO. Sử dụng các công cụ như Google PageSpeed Insights để phân tích và tối ưu hóa thời gian tải trang của bạn.
2. Tỷ lệ thoát
Tỷ lệ thoát cao có thể là dấu hiệu của vấn đề về nội dung hoặc hiệu suất. Theo dõi tỷ lệ này và phân tích các trang có tỷ lệ thoát cao để đưa ra giải pháp cải thiện.
Khắc phục sự cố
Khi phát hiện ra vấn đề, bạn cần có kế hoạch khắc phục cụ thể:
1. Tăng cường tài nguyên
Nếu máy chủ của bạn thường xuyên vượt quá sử dụng tài nguyên, hãy xem xét việc nâng cấp phần cứng hoặc sử dụng dịch vụ CDN để phân phối tải.
2. Tối ưu hóa mã nguồn
Kiểm tra mã nguồn của bạn để tìm ra những điểm không hiệu quả và tối ưu hóa chúng. Điều này có thể bao gồm việc giảm kích thước hình ảnh, sử dụng bộ nhớ cache, và tối ưu hóa cơ sở dữ liệu.
Kết luận
Giám sát cấu hình hệ thống là một phần rất quan trọng trong việc duy trì hiệu quả của một blog có lưu lượng truy cập cao. Việc thực hiện các bước kiểm tra và điều chỉnh cần thiết sẽ giúp bạn bảo đảm rằng hệ thống hoạt động ổn định và đáp ứng nhu cầu của người dùng. Đối với những người cần giải pháp hạ tầng mạnh mẽ, có thể tham khảo dịch vụ của Trum VPS để có thêm thông tin.


